WebJan 30, 2024 · The p orbitals at the second energy level are called 2p x, 2p y and 2p z. There are similar orbitals at subsequent levels - 3p x, 3p y, 3p z, 4p x, 4p y, 4p z and so on. All levels except for the first level have p orbitals. At the higher levels the lobes get more elongated, with the most likely place to find the electron more distant from the ... WebSep 7, 2024 · Biochemical reactions preferentially use carbon-12 over carbon-13. Carbon-14 is a radioisotope that occurs naturally. It is made in the atmosphere when cosmic rays interact with nitrogen. The ground state electron configuration of carbon is 1s 2 2s 2 2p 2.For excited states, the most typical situation is that five of the electrons maintain the configuration 1s 2 2s 2 2p 1 and a single electron is elevated.
